    Abstract: The present invention relates to a marker-detecting composition and a detection method for detecting therapeutic capability or proliferation capability of adipose-derived stem cells cultivated in a culture medium containing an epidermal growth factor (EGF) or a basic fibroblast growth factor (bFBF). The marker-detecting composition comprises an agent for measuring the level of mRNA or its protein of at least one gene selected from the group consisting of Kazal-type serine peptidase inhibitor domain 1 (KAZALD1), proenkephalin (PENK), lipopolysaccharide binding protein (LBP), and lipase, endothelial (LIPG).

    Abstract: The present invention relates to a composition used in marker detection for detecting differentiation potency of adipocyte-derived stem cells comprising one or more mRNAs selected from a group including proenkephalin (PENK), kynureninase, L-kynurenine hydrolase (KYNU), kazal-type serine peptidase inhibitor domain 1 (KAZALD1), calmegin (CLGN), small cell adhesion glycoprotein (SMAGP), scavenger receptor class A, member 3 (SCARA3), epithelial stromal interaction 1 (EPSTI1), limb bud and heart development homolog (LBH), lipase, endothelial (LIPG), lipopolysaccharide binding protein (LBP), PRKC, apoptosis, WT1, regulator (PAWR), and secreted frizzled-related protein 2 (SFRP2), or a formulation which measures protein level thereof; a composition used in marker detection for measuring potency of the adipocyte-derived stem cell therapy products; to a composition used in marker detection for measuring senescence of the adipocyte-derived stem cells; and to uses thereof.
